We have an understanding of the unpredictable nature of roof destruction and emergencies, Specially how they tend to occur at by far the most demanding occasions. With Vainness Roofing, you can be assured figuring out that our highly competent Roof Repair Professionals will be there to suit your needs any time you have to have it the most.Whilst a